Hard Hill

hill or mountain · Dumfries and Galloway

Old EnglishAI-generated

This name describes a hill that is challenging to ascend or has a stony terrain. It is composed of the Old English adjective 'heard' meaning 'hard, rough, difficult' and 'hyll', meaning 'hill'.
